编程之心嵌入式开发的精髓探秘
一、编程之心:嵌入式开发的精髓探秘
二、嵌入式系统与软件工程的交汇点
在现代电子产品中,嵌入式系统已经成为不可或缺的一部分,它们通过微型化和集成化技术,使得计算机控制变得更加灵活和高效。然而,这种技术背后隐藏着复杂的软件工程问题。如何设计出既可靠又具有实时性要求的嵌入式软件,是这项工作中的一个核心挑战。
三、硬件与软件相互融合:嵌入式开发中的挑战与机遇
随着技术的发展,硬件设备越来越小巧,但其性能却日益强大。这就为嵌入式开发带来了新的挑战和机遇。如何有效地将这些高性能硬件与复杂的软件需求结合起来,是当前研发人员面临的一个重要课题。在这一过程中,深度理解两者之间关系,对于创造出更先进、高效率的产品至关重要。
四、实时操作系统在嵌입式开发中的应用
为了应对高速数据处理和即时响应需求,在许多领域都广泛使用了实时操作系统(RTOS)。它能够提供稳定且可预测性的运行环境,使得关键任务如汽车驾驶辅助系统、中医健康监测等能够准确无误地执行。此外,RTOS还能优化资源分配,以便更好地适应不同类型设备上的不同应用场景。
五、安全性考量:保护隐私与防止漏洞
随着智能家居、大数据分析等新兴行业不断崛起,用户个人信息被大量收集并用于个性化服务。然而,这也增加了隐私泄露以及恶意攻击风险。在这样的背景下,不仅要考虑到功能上线,更需要从安全角度进行思考,如采用加密算法保护敏感信息,以及定期更新固件以修补可能存在的问题,从而构建一个安全且透明的人工智能世界。
六、新兴趋势:物联网时代下的嵌入式开发未来展望
物联网(IoT)革命正在改变我们的生活方式,它使得传感器网络、自动化设备以及其他连接互联网设备变得普遍。而这正是基于微型计算能力和低功耗处理器的大量生产所必需。这不仅推动了对芯片制造业产生新的需求,也激励了研究人员持续改进现有技术,并探索全新的解决方案,以满足不断增长的市场需求。
七、结语:未来的可能性与责任担当
作为科技前沿领域之一,嵌入式开发正迎来春天。但是,我们不能忽视伴随其发展而来的伦理责任问题。我们必须确保这种创新不会导致社会不公平,而是应该用科技为人类带来福祉,同时尊重自然界及人际关系。此外,与全球合作分享知识,将有助于促进共同繁荣,为这个充满希望但也充满挑战的地球提供更多机会。